Temple Dominates St. Francis (NY) In Home Opener

PHILADELPHIA - Temple put forth a dominant effort in its home opener on Friday at the Arthur Ashe Tennis Center, dismantling St. Francis (NY), 7-0. The Owls dropped just one set in singles play and did not drop a single game, winning 6-0, 6-0 at every position from third to sixth singles.

"It was a good team effort today," head coach Steve Mauro said. "The guys have been working hard and we're back on the winning track."

The Cherry and White (2-4) opened things up by decisively winning the doubles point. Senior Eduardo Saavedra and freshman Filip Rams beat Jindrich Chaloupka and Daniel Gonzalez, 8-3, at first doubles while senior Ricardo Velazquez and junior Pavlos Stephanides defeated Danlahdi Robinson and James Brennan Tsang, 8-2, at second doubles. Senior Nathan Spunda and freshman Dmitry Vizhunov did not drop a game in an 8-0 victory over Vihren Todorov and Darrius Marcellin at third doubles.

The singles play was just as impressive. Beginning with Vizhunov at third singles, the Owls did not drop a game, winning 6-0, 6-0. Freshman Mansur Gishkaev at fourth singles, Saavedra at fifth singles and Stephanides at sixth singles all dispatched their opponents easily.

Rams rebounded from dropping the first set to win at first singles, 1-6, 6-4, 6-4, while Spunda captured a 6-1, 6-2 victory at second singles.

St. Francis (NY) drops to 2-5 with the loss.

With their four losses coming to teams that currently have a 20-3 record, the Owls will begin a stretch of three straight matches against Atlantic 10 or city rivals. Next up for the team is a visit to George Washington (0-1) on Friday, Feb. 6 at 1 PM.
